Geneva . Voted All-America City 2015, Geneva is the perfect place to go for a quiet, relaxing lakefront vacation. Geneva is on the northernmost tip of Seneca Lake and features a bustling downtown district and fantastic cultural attractions. See a show at the Smith Opera House or tour the many local historic houses.

Which Finger Lake is the cleanest?

The cleanest of the lakes is Skaneateles Lake , which is considered one of the cleanest in the United States and passes to homes unfiltered. There are waterfront restaurants to enjoy its crystalline lake views and designated swimming areas. At 16 miles long, it spans through Onondaga, Cayuga, and Cortland counties.

Which is better Cayuga Lake or Seneca Lake?

The two longest, Cayuga Lake and Seneca Lake, are among the deepest in America. Both are close to 40 miles from end to end, but never more than 3.5 miles wide. Cayuga is the longest (38.1 miles), but Seneca the largest in total area. Seneca is the deepest (618 feet), followed by Cayuga (435 feet).

What is the best time to visit the Finger Lakes?

The best time to visit the Finger Lakes region is from May to September , when there are plenty of opportunities to take advantage of the area’s outdoor pursuits. Expect higher accommodation rates in the peak months of June to August and longer lines at attractions and wineries.

Which Finger Lake is the most polluted?

Onondaga Lake in Syracuse, N.Y. , has often been called the most polluted lake in America. It was hammered by a one-two punch: raw and partially treated sewage from the city and its suburbs, and a century’s worth of industrial dumping.

Why do the Finger Lakes not freeze?

The lakes are very, very deep.

That means the lakes don’t freeze very easily because they retain heat so well . (Think of a tall coffee cup compared to a bowl.) It’s also why Lake Ontario, with a maximum depth over 800 feet, stays open all winter while Lake Erie often freezes over.

What is the deepest Finger Lake?

Seneca Lake is the deepest of the Finger Lakes (618 ft. depth). Honeoye Lake’s maximum depth is approximately 30 feet. Despite its Native American translation meaning “Long Lake,” Canadice Lake is the smallest of the Finger Lakes, measuring under 4 miles long.

Is Cayuga Lake clean?

The lake is clean enough to serve as a drinking water supply now , but that’s threatened by considerable agricultural activity, wastewater sources and other nutrient loading from the watershed, according to a state Department of Health evaluation.

Is Keuka Lake clean?

The testing results for Keuka Lake indicate the lake, overall, is in very good condition . The waters are relatively clear, contain low nutrient levels and have a sufficient algae growth to support excellent fisheries. The exceptions are bacterial levels and runoff following storm events.

Where can I watch sunrise in Finger Lakes?

Carolabarb Park – Overlooking Canandaigua Lake just north of Naples, the view catches sunrise and sunset, fall foliage and falling snow, summer sun and spring bloom. There simply is not a bad time to pull out the camera and capture the beauty of the Finger Lakes from this vantage point.
